#e4cea4 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#e4cea4 is composed of 89.4% red, 80.8% green and 64.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 9.6% magenta, 28.1%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 39.4 degrees, a saturation of 54.2% and a lightness of 76.9%. #e4cea4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c99d49.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

● #e4cea4 color description : Very soft orange.
The hexadecimal color #e4cea4 has RGB values of R:228, G:206, B:164 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.1, Y:0.28,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14995108.
